Framer vs Snapweb

Both Framer and Snapweb use AI to generate websites from text. But Framer gates publishing behind a paywall, while Snapweb publishes a live site for free. Here is how they stack up across the things that actually matter.

Framer earned its reputation by producing some of the most visually polished AI-generated sites available. It is built on React, loved by product designers, and its AI feature generates layouts that look genuinely impressive out of the box. The design-first community has adopted it widely, and for good reason — the output quality is hard to beat.

The catch is the free plan. Framer lets you generate and preview a site at no cost, but the moment you want to publish it to a real URL, you are paying. Starting at $5/month that is not a large barrier, but it is a barrier — and it changes the proposition significantly compared to tools that let you go live for free.

Snapweb does not match Framer's visual polish, but it publishes immediately without asking for a credit card. The AI generates complete copy, a hero image, and a working page in under 60 seconds. For non-designers who need something live today — not something that might launch after a subscription decision — Snapweb removes every obstacle between idea and published URL.

Bottom line

Choose Framer if you are a designer or work in a design-oriented team, you care deeply about visual output quality, and you are willing to pay from $5/month to publish. Framer's React export and animation tools make it a legitimate professional tool for the right audience.

Choose Snapweb if you need a published site today without a credit card or a design background. Snapweb's free plan is genuinely free — not a trial, not a preview — and its file hosting feature covers use cases Framer does not touch. For small businesses, freelancers, and anyone who values speed over pixel-perfect layouts, Snapweb is the faster path to a live web presence.

Do I need to know how to code to use Snapweb or Framer?

Neither tool requires coding to generate a site. However, Framer rewards some design knowledge — its editor has more manual controls that can overwhelm complete beginners. Snapweb requires nothing beyond a text description of your business and works equally well for first-time users as for experienced marketers.

Can I switch from Framer to Snapweb later?

Yes. Your content is not locked into either platform. With Snapweb, you can regenerate or update your site at any time using the AI or the inline editor. If you start with Framer and want a simpler or cheaper setup, Snapweb's free plan makes it easy to publish a replacement site in under a minute.
